The celebrated Mughal Gardens at the Rashtrapati Bhavan in Delhi boasts over 150 varieties of roses, tulips, Asiatic lilies, daffodils and other ornamental flowers, and is spread over 15 acres.

Mughal Gardens Renamed 'Amrit Udyan': The Mughal Gardens, now renamed 'Amrit Udyan', is spread over 15 acres. It has often been portrayed as the “soul of the Presidential palace”, the website says. It will be opened on January 29 by President Droupadi Murmu.
